Transaction 57b8ae216df895859bfd77a74e35fe4f261343a65fd3115c8319f8cbf7957a62
1 Input
1 Output
-
57b8ae216df895859bfd77a74e35fe4f261343a65fd3115c8319f8cbf7957a62:0
- value
- 103737788
- script pubkey
- OP_0 OP_PUSHBYTES_20 805fa961605e68dfb6df608f9b7cbcc6965f5fee
- address
- bc1qsp06jctqte5dldklvz8ekl9uc6t97hlw2rauw0